President Duterte throws in additional P2 million incentive for Olympic heroine Hidilyn Diaz

Aug 11, 2016
Hidilyn Diaz all smiles upon her arrival from the Olympic Games in Rio de Janeiro. Jaime Campos

PRESIDENT Duterte has thrown in an P2 million incentive for Hidilyn Diaz for winning a silver medal in the weightlifting competitions of the Rio De Janeiro Olympics.

Duterte announced the additional incentives during a courtesy call by Diaz in Davao City.

With Duterte's announcement, Diaz will now receive a total of P7 million, with P5 million coming from the government through Republic Act 10699 or the National Athletes and Coaches and Trainers Benefits and Incentives Act.

Other pledges are also starting to come in, with the MVP Sports Foundation, through Al Panlilio, promising to help Diaz rehabilitate the gym she runs in his native Zamboanga City.

The Philippine Sports Commission (PSC) has also forged a partnership with a partner company that promised to reward the 25-year-old silver medalist with a brand-new house and lot.
